improve goto_if macros
This commit is contained in:
@@ -43,9 +43,9 @@ SSTidalRooms_EventScript_23C03C:: @ 823C03C
|
||||
|
||||
SSTidalCorridor_EventScript_23C050:: @ 823C050
|
||||
compare VAR_PORTHOLE_STATE, 2
|
||||
goto_eq SSTidalCorridor_EventScript_23C067
|
||||
goto_if_eq SSTidalCorridor_EventScript_23C067
|
||||
compare VAR_PORTHOLE_STATE, 7
|
||||
goto_eq SSTidalCorridor_EventScript_23C07D
|
||||
goto_if_eq SSTidalCorridor_EventScript_23C07D
|
||||
end
|
||||
|
||||
SSTidalCorridor_EventScript_23C067:: @ 823C067
|
||||
@@ -115,9 +115,9 @@ SSTidalCorridor_EventScript_23C119:: @ 823C119
|
||||
lock
|
||||
faceplayer
|
||||
compare VAR_PORTHOLE_STATE, 4
|
||||
goto_eq SSTidalCorridor_EventScript_23C13B
|
||||
goto_if_eq SSTidalCorridor_EventScript_23C13B
|
||||
compare VAR_PORTHOLE_STATE, 8
|
||||
goto_eq SSTidalCorridor_EventScript_23C15A
|
||||
goto_if_eq SSTidalCorridor_EventScript_23C15A
|
||||
msgbox SSTidalCorridor_Text_23C596, MSGBOX_DEFAULT
|
||||
release
|
||||
end
|
||||
@@ -149,9 +149,9 @@ SSTidalCorridor_EventScript_23C179:: @ 823C179
|
||||
SSTidalCorridor_EventScript_23C17D:: @ 823C17D
|
||||
lockall
|
||||
compare VAR_PORTHOLE_STATE, 2
|
||||
goto_eq SSTidalCorridor_EventScript_23C19E
|
||||
goto_if_eq SSTidalCorridor_EventScript_23C19E
|
||||
compare VAR_PORTHOLE_STATE, 7
|
||||
goto_eq SSTidalCorridor_EventScript_23C19E
|
||||
goto_if_eq SSTidalCorridor_EventScript_23C19E
|
||||
msgbox SSTidalCorridor_Text_23C6C3, MSGBOX_DEFAULT
|
||||
releaseall
|
||||
end
|
||||
@@ -164,8 +164,7 @@ SSTidalCorridor_EventScript_23C19E:: @ 823C19E
|
||||
SSTidalCorridor_EventScript_23C1A3:: @ 823C1A3
|
||||
lock
|
||||
faceplayer
|
||||
checkflag FLAG_0x0F7
|
||||
goto_eq SSTidalCorridor_EventScript_23C1BD
|
||||
goto_if_set FLAG_0x0F7, SSTidalCorridor_EventScript_23C1BD
|
||||
call SSTidalCorridor_EventScript_23C1C7
|
||||
msgbox SSTidalCorridor_Text_23C65E, MSGBOX_DEFAULT
|
||||
release
|
||||
@@ -178,21 +177,21 @@ SSTidalCorridor_EventScript_23C1BD:: @ 823C1BD
|
||||
|
||||
SSTidalCorridor_EventScript_23C1C7:: @ 823C1C7
|
||||
checktrainerflag TRAINER_PHILLIP
|
||||
goto_if 0, SSTidalCorridor_EventScript_23C218
|
||||
goto_if_lt SSTidalCorridor_EventScript_23C218
|
||||
checktrainerflag TRAINER_LEONARD
|
||||
goto_if 0, SSTidalCorridor_EventScript_23C218
|
||||
goto_if_lt SSTidalCorridor_EventScript_23C218
|
||||
checktrainerflag TRAINER_COLTON
|
||||
goto_if 0, SSTidalCorridor_EventScript_23C218
|
||||
goto_if_lt SSTidalCorridor_EventScript_23C218
|
||||
checktrainerflag TRAINER_MICAH
|
||||
goto_if 0, SSTidalCorridor_EventScript_23C218
|
||||
goto_if_lt SSTidalCorridor_EventScript_23C218
|
||||
checktrainerflag TRAINER_THOMAS
|
||||
goto_if 0, SSTidalCorridor_EventScript_23C218
|
||||
goto_if_lt SSTidalCorridor_EventScript_23C218
|
||||
checktrainerflag TRAINER_LEA_AND_JED
|
||||
goto_if 0, SSTidalCorridor_EventScript_23C218
|
||||
goto_if_lt SSTidalCorridor_EventScript_23C218
|
||||
checktrainerflag TRAINER_GARRET
|
||||
goto_if 0, SSTidalCorridor_EventScript_23C218
|
||||
goto_if_lt SSTidalCorridor_EventScript_23C218
|
||||
checktrainerflag TRAINER_NAOMI
|
||||
goto_if 0, SSTidalCorridor_EventScript_23C218
|
||||
goto_if_lt SSTidalCorridor_EventScript_23C218
|
||||
setflag FLAG_0x0F7
|
||||
goto SSTidalCorridor_EventScript_23C1BD
|
||||
return
|
||||
|
||||
Reference in New Issue
Block a user